### I. European and American Automotive Paint Giants: Technological Leadership and Comprehensive Systems
Europe and America are the birthplaces of modern automotive paints, with brands generally boasting over a century of history, long dominating the OEM and refinish paint sectors.
1. **PPG (USA)** – Absolute leader in the global first tier
PPG has a complete system in automotive coatings, including metal primers, intermediate color paints, anti-corrosion systems, high-solid clear coats, and advanced waterborne eco-friendly systems. Its clients include international automakers such as Ford, General Motors, and Tesla.
2. **Axalta (USA)** – Global king in the refinish paint sector
Its brands Standox, Cromax, and Spies Hecker are top-tier in automotive refinish paints, renowned for color accuracy and spray consistency, highly favored by professional body shops.
3. **AkzoNobel (Netherlands)** – Representative of European technology routes
Its Sikkens series is known for weather resistance, stability, and eco-friendliness, dominating the high-end European market.
4. **Sherwin-Williams (USA)** – Strong in commercial and industrial vehicle paints
Leveraging its extensive distribution network, its automotive coatings are widely used in North American trucks, construction vehicles, and various commercial vehicle markets.
### II. Classic European High-End Brands: Leading Color Systems and Spraying Experience
5. **BASF Coatings (Germany)** – Core partner for German car series
High-end brands like Mercedes-Benz, BMW, and Audi extensively use BASF’s OEM paints, with its highly stable clear coats and metallic paint systems being globally competitive.
6. **Glasurit (Germany)** – Synonym for high-end refinish paints
Known for accurate color matching and a vast color library, it is the preferred spray material for many European certified repair systems.
7. **Lechler (Italy)** – Strong brand for artistic custom paints
It features European-specific technologies in effect colors, metallic flakes, pearlescent, and other specialty paints.
### III. Asian Automotive Paint Brands: High Capacity, Fast Growth, Wide Application
8. **Kansai Paint (Japan)**
Deeply involved in the OEM paint market, it is a key partner for Japanese brands like Toyota and Honda.
9. **Nippon Paint (Japan/Singapore)**
Has a strong presence in industrial paints, architectural paints, and some automotive coating products, with significantly increased influence in the Asian market.
10. **KCC (South Korea)**
Rapidly expanding its OEM paint business, relying on the South Korean automotive industry (Hyundai, Kia).

### V. Nano-Coating and Ceramic Coating Brands: Emerging Forces on the Rise
With the increasing demand for automotive protection, nano-coating and ceramic coating brands featuring superhydrophobicity, scratch resistance, and corrosion resistance are quickly capturing the market.
14. **Gtechniq (UK)**
One of the world’s top ceramic coating brands, known for chemical resistance and high hardness.
15. **Ceramic Pro (USA)**
Highly influential in global detailing shop systems, representing high-end protective coatings.
16. **IGL Coatings (Malaysia)**
Rising with eco-friendly ceramic coatings, growing rapidly in Europe and America.
